Williamsburg came tearing into Saturday's game with seven straight wins (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 7.1 runs), and they left with even more momentum. They came within a single run of losing the streak, but they secured a 3-2 W against the Benton Bobcats.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est victory the Raiders have posted since June 24th.
Williamsburg pushed their record up to 31-7 with the win, which was their ninth straight on the road. Those road victories came thanks in part to their pitching effort, having only surrendered 2.2 runs on average over those games. As for Benton, their loss ended a three-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 19-14.
As of now, neither Williamsburg nor the Bobcats have any future games scheduled.
